Hello, and welcome to my first ever Cruise Trip Report! I have done a WDW trip report (and will be working on a pre-cruise WDW TR again), but this is my first Cruise TR! I have enjoyed reading SO many other cruise reports, and they have been so helpful with planning this trip, so I thought I'd give it a go. Our January '19 SWDAS Trip Report!
First, some intros!
WHO: Ali (34) and DH Donnie (32)
WHAT: Star Wars Day at Sea Cruise
WHERE: Disney Fantasy, Western Caribbean
WHEN: January 5- January 12, 2019
WHY: Why NOT?! Haha.
Okay, so perhaps the "why" needs a bit more explanation? We had had a Disney cruise planned for 3 years ago: it was to be a 5 night Western cruise out of Miami. Unfortunately, we had to cancel the cruise 3 days before sailing because my mother passed away. We have taken 2 WDW trips since then, but I still felt the 'call to the sea' since we didn't get to go on our previously planned cruise. This cruise was to make up for our missed cruise, and we deserved it!
DH is halfway through his 3 year MFA program (studying Arts Leadership), so it seemed like a nice halfway done vacation, too! We did a week long WDW vacay July '17 and are hoping to visit Disneyland for his graduation in the spring of 2020.
I work full-time at a Dinner Theatre as an actor, singer, dancer, choreographer, director, cast house manager... the list goes on and on. Christmas season is exceptionally busy at the theatre, so taking a January vacation was perfect timing for me.
We left chilly SW Virginia January 1 around 6 a.m., drove the approximately 10 hours to Orlando, and spent four wonderful nights at Bay Lake Tower before boarding the Fantasy. We spent 3 very full (and very busy) days at WDW. After the craziness of WDW the days after New Years, we were really looking forward to some relaxation and quiet, and hopefully less crowds and craziness!
